    ECM 1227783 1987 LG3 Pontiac Bonneville

    Hi guys, I need a little help. This is my first post here, so bear with me. My '87 Bonneville had a toasted 440T4 trans. I swapped in a 4t65-e and I'm running the diesel TCM standalone for that. All of the old transmissions diagnostics go through the current 1227783 PCM and I want to prevent any check engine lights from cropping up, this will be my wife's car and I don't want her worried. So, I want to tell the PCM that it is now in a manual shifted car, I want to enable highway mode and I want to turn off some of the diagnostics.

    I could normally do all of that. But I found out that there is very little support for this PCM... like nothing, I have been searching for hours. So I guess I'm looking for an XDF file for a $44 mask AKBA code PROM. or help in making my own XDF file.
